Sidescan® Predict
AVA’s Sidescan Predict is a detection sensor system that uses ultrasonic technology to predict if a collision is likely to occur. It can detect objects in under 200 milliseconds and its learning mode prevents false alarms.

The new proposed regulations for DVS are coming into place in October 2024. This states that HGVs with a DVS rating of two stars or lower must have a DVS Progressive Safety System. This system includes MOIS, which alerts drivers of any hazards in front of the vehicle. Additionally, a nearside detection system is required to identify vulnerable road users accurately without producing false alarms for static objects.
